Two Turkish producers have cut their ship scrap purchase prices by $5-10/mt as compared to the levels reported on August 16. The general price range for ship scrap now stands at $365-375/mt as compared to the previous levels of $370-380/mt. The reason of the latest downward revision is the negative sentiment in Turkey’s scrap markets, both import and domestic.
In Turkey’s Izmir region, the ship scrap purchase prices of local steelmakers are as follows:
Producer |
Price ($/mt) |
Price change ($/mt) |
Özkan Demir Çelik |
370 |
0 |
Habaş |
370 |
-10 |
Ege Çelik |
365 |
-5 |
İDÇ |
370 |
0 |
Çebitaş |
375 |
0 |
All the above prices are for delivery to mill by truck.
